AMSOIL Heavy Duty Synthetic 15w40 Diesel Marine OilAMSOIL Heavy Duty 15w40 Synthetic Diesel Marine Oil is a premium diesel oil engineered for pre-2007 over-the-road diesel truck engines as well as all model year diesel engines in off-road applications. It has been put to the test over millions of miles in heavy-duty trucks. It is proven to provide unsurpassed engine protection, even when used much longer than conventional diesel oils are used.

AMSOIL Heavy Duty 15w40 Synthetic Diesel Marine Oil provides clean engine performance. Built with heavy-duty dispersant/detergent additives, its high 12-TBN chemistry neutralizes acids and controls soot loading from exhaust gas recirculation (EGR) and blow-by to protect against corrosion, cylinder bore polishing (wear), ring sticking and varnish and sludge deposits. AMSOIL 15w40 Diesel Marine Oil resists heat and breakdown better than conventional petroleum oils for long lasting performance and protection. Extended oil change intervals reduce downtime, motor oil expenses and waste oil disposal costs.

Offers Better Fuel Economy, Reduces Oil Consumption and Emissions

AMSOIL Heavy Duty 15w40 Synthetic Diesel Marine Oil has lower volatility (evaporation) than conventional petroleum oils. Lower volatility means AMSOIL 15w40 Diesel Marine Oil retains its viscosity at temperatures and loads that break down conventional oils, offering better fuel economy and continued dependable protection. Lower volatility also means less make-up oil is required to replace volatilized oil and less oil vapor gets into the combustion chamber, reducing oil consumption and exhaust emissions.

Controls Excessive Soot Loading Found in EGR Diesel Engines

AMSOIL Heavy Duty 15w40 Synthetic Diesel Marine Oil is heavily fortified with detergent/dispersant additives and is naturally resistant to soot. It is designed to keep soot particles suspended independently, preventing them from attaching together to form larger, wear-causing particles. Viscosity increase is minimized and soot-related diesel engine wear is controlled.

Excels in Cold Weather

Unlike conventional petroleum oils, AMSOIL Heavy Duty 15w40 Synthetic Diesel Marine Oil contains no wax. It stays fluid down to -44°F for improved cold-temperature oil flow, providing vital start-up lubrication for easier starts and reduced wear. AMSOIL 15w40 Diesel Marine Oil outperforms conventional 15w40 petroleum oils and greatly minimizes the impact of cold weather operation.

All-Season Oil — Eliminates the Need for Special Inventories of Seasonal Oils

AMSOIL Heavy Duty 15w40 Synthetic Diesel Marine Oil will not shear back to a lower viscosity. This is especially important for engines that operate continually at constant speed, such as stationary engines, marine engines and farm tractors. Traditionally, such engines have been lubricated with high-viscosity single-grade oils, such as SAE 40, to avoid oil shear-back (which sometimes occurs with multi-viscosity oils using low-quality viscosity index improvers). However, single-grade oils are too thick to allow easy starting and quick engine lubrication in cold temperatures. AMSOIL 15w40 Diesel Marine Oil provides the high-temperature protection of an SAE 40 and the low-temperature pumpability of a 15W oil throughout its entire service life. All-season, all-temperature AMSOIL 15w40 Diesel Marine Oil eliminates the need for special inventories of seasonal oils.

Prevents Rust and Corrosion — Important to Marine Engines and Farm Equipment

AMSOIL Heavy Duty 15w40 Synthetic Diesel Marine Oil contains special rust and corrosion inhibitors that protect engines from internal rust, which is especially important for marine engines or equipment that is stored long-term, such as farm equipment.

Less Foam Means Better Drivability

AMSOIL Synthetic Diesel Oil Foam Test ComparisonsSome vehicles have been known to suffer drive-ability problems due to oil foaming. Foamy oil interferes with fuel injection, which reduces engine power. The ASTM D892 Foam Test, Sequences 2 and 4, are used to evaluate diesel oils on their foaming characteristics.

According to test results, AMSOIL Synthetic Diesel Oils are clearly less prone to foaming (see graph). Not only are AMSOIL Synthetic Diesels Oils less prone to foaming, they also dissipate foam more quickly and excel in comparison to Shell Rotella T, a popular diesel oil often recommended by some engine manufacturers.

Extended Oil Change Intervals

AMSOIL Heavy Duty 15w40 Synthetic Diesel Marine Oil is a proven long-drain oil and can extend oil change intervals far beyond those recommended for conventional oils. Its unique synthetic formulation and long-drain additive system delivers maximum engine protection, cleanliness and performance over extended oil drain intervals, reducing vehicle maintenance and waste oil disposal costs. AMSOIL 15w40 Diesel Marine Motor Oil is recommended for extended oil change intervals in unmodified, mechanically sound vehicles or equipment as follows:

Diesel Engine Service:

Three times (3X) OEM* recommendation, not to exceed 50,000 miles/600 hours or one year, whichever comes first. Drain intervals may be extended further with oil analysis.

Gasoline Engine Service:

Two times 2(X) OEM* recommendation, not to exceed 15,000 miles or one year, whichever comes first.

*Original Equipment Manufacturer. Operating conditions and drain intervals for severe and normal service are defined by the OEM. Refer to your owner's manual.

Note: extended oil drain intervals are not recommended when using biofuels containing >10% ethanol or 5% biodiesel (B5). Follow OEM drain intervals or extend drain intervals with oil analysis.

Applications

AMSOIL Heavy Duty 15w40 Synthetic Diesel Marine Oil is engineered for use in a wide variety of light- and heavy-duty applications, including over-the-road trucks, off-road construction, marine engines, farm equipment, logging and mining equipment and industrial (pumps & generators). It is ideal for personal automotive or commercial transportation, such as taxi and local delivery fleets, with gasoline or diesel engines. It is excellent for use with low- or high-sulfur diesel fuels in standard, turbocharged or supercharged engines, including modern low-emission diesels such as those equipped with exhaust gas recirculation systems (EGR).
